Position Candidate Name Party Votes Vote %
1 Dhan Shah Independent 126,609 71.70%
2 Girja Kumari Indian National Congress 29,165 16.50%
3 Kundan Singh Praja Socialist Party 3,969 2.20%
4 Shanker Singh Communist Party Of India 3,491 2.00%
5 Buddha Singh Utaiya Samyukta Socialist Party 3,087 1.70%

Dhan Shah (Independent) won the Shahdol Lok Sabha seat in 1971.

The margin was 97,444 votes (55.20%%).

The voter turnout in Shahdol for the 1971 Lok Sabha election was 35.10%%.

5 candidates contested from Shahdol constituency in the 1971 Lok Sabha election.

Shahdol is a Lok Sabha constituency in Madhya Pradesh.
